Solution Overview
Problem
Existing methods struggle to accurately measure the eccentricity of a thin coating around a small-diameter optical fiber using scattered light analysis, as the thickness of the coating makes it difficult to determine the eccentricity with respect to the glass fiber.
Innovation Solution
A method involving a controller that acquires measurement values for the outer diameter of the optical fiber at various positions, calculates the standard deviation, and determines the eccentricity based on this calculation, allowing for adjustment of the resin coating unit to maintain an acceptable eccentricity level, even for thin coatings.
Engineering Contradictions & Design Principles
Engineering Contradiction Analysis
1Measurement precision
If laser beam scattered light analysis is used to measure coating eccentricity, then measurement method is established, but measurement precision deteriorates when coating thickness is thin
Solution Approach 1:
The invention changes the measurement parameter from direct scattered light pattern analysis to outer diameter variation analysis. By measuring outer diameter at multiple positions along the optical fiber and calculating standard deviation, the method achieves reliable eccentricity determination even for thin coatings where scattered light analysis fails.
Solution Approach 2:
The invention introduces an intermediary measurement approach - instead of directly analyzing the coating's scattered light pattern, it measures the outer diameter of the entire optical fiber (glass core + coating) at multiple positions. The standard deviation of these outer diameter measurements serves as an intermediary parameter that reflects coating eccentricity regardless of coating thickness.
2Reliability
If real-time eccentricity measurement is implemented during manufacturing, then quality control is improved, but measurement and control complexity increases
Solution Approach 1:
The measurement system uses the optical fiber's own outer diameter characteristics to determine eccentricity. By measuring outer diameter variations along the fiber length, the system self-determines coating eccentricity without requiring complex additional measurement apparatus or sophisticated analysis methods.
Solution Approach 2:
The invention implements a feedback control system where the calculated standard deviation of outer diameter measurements is fed back to adjust the resin coating unit's tilt angle. This closed-loop feedback enables real-time correction of coating eccentricity during the manufacturing process, improving quality while keeping the control mechanism relatively simple.

An eccentric state determining method which is performed by a controller and for determining a state of eccentricity of a coating of a glass fiber with respect to the glass fiber. The coating is formed around the glass fiber. The method includes acquiring measurement values for an outer diameter of the optical fiber at positions along a longitudinal direction of the optical fiber, calculating a standard deviation of the measurement values, and determining the state of the eccentricity based on the standard deviation.
